Gary,

My advice is open up the enclosure and pull the physical hard drive out
from inside and put it in a new box.  It sounds like the enclosure may be
malfunctioning.

If it is a full size desktop hard drive I recommend these enclosures:

If the drive is a 2.5"  drive ...or you want something that can do both, i
recommend this nifty device:

http://www.amazon.com/Anker®-Uspeed-Converter-Adapter-included/dp/B005B3VO24/ref=sr_1_3

Little adapter that just clips to the top of the hard drive, connects to a
computer.  With optional power cable for desktop hard drives.

....or bring it to a local tech shop that has things like this and have
them transfer the files for you.

> I am having another odd issue, this time with a portable Lacie drive.
> I used it actively as a backup drive until one of the pins on the
> power supply broke. I finally replaced the power supply cord and the
> drive is now running, sort of. Problem is that neither of the pc's on
> which I tried it can recognize it anymore. I thought at first that it
> was just another thing going wrong with my laptop and then tried it on
> my other one. BOTH of these are laptops with which I have used the
> drive previously, for years. I get an error message saying that the
> device has malfunctioned and it doesn't even appear in a Windows
> Explorer list. However, it DOES work just fine plugged into an iMac
> G4. Anyone ever run into anything like this before and have any
> suggestions for getting it to work again?
